DNA repair gene
A gene engaged in DNA repair. When a DNA repair gene is impaired, mutations pile up throughout the DNA. The DNA in genes is constantly mutating and being repaired. This repair process is controlled by special genes. A mutation in a DNA repair gene can cripple the repair process and cause a cascade of unrepaired mutations in the genome that lead to cancer.
